Potential Risks and Side Effects of High-Dosage Viagra
Taking more Viagra than prescribed significantly increases the risk of side effects. Common side effects, even at recommended doses, include headaches, facial flushing, nasal congestion, and indigestion. Higher doses drastically amplify these effects, potentially making them severe and uncomfortable.
Cardiovascular Risks
Increased risk of heart attack or stroke is a serious concern with high-dose Viagra. This is because Viagra enhances blood flow throughout the body, putting extra strain on the cardiovascular system. If you have pre-existing heart conditions, high doses should be strictly avoided. Always consult your doctor before using Viagra, especially if you have heart problems, high blood pressure, or high cholesterol.
Vision Problems
High doses can cause temporary vision changes, including blurred vision, increased light sensitivity, or even temporary blue-tinged vision. In rare cases, more serious vision problems have been reported. If you experience any vision changes while using Viagra, discontinue use and seek immediate medical attention.
Hearing Problems
While less common, high doses of Viagra have been linked to temporary or permanent hearing loss. This risk is increased in individuals with pre-existing hearing problems. Sudden hearing loss requires immediate medical intervention.

Seeking Professional Medical Advice for Erectile Dysfunction
Schedule a consultation with a urologist or your primary care physician. They can perform a physical exam and discuss your medical history, including any medications you’re taking.
Openly discuss your symptoms and concerns. Provide details about the frequency, duration, and severity of erectile dysfunction. Be honest about lifestyle factors like smoking, alcohol consumption, and exercise habits. Accurate information helps your doctor make an accurate diagnosis.
Expect a thorough evaluation. This might involve blood tests to check hormone levels and cholesterol, or a sleep study if sleep apnea is suspected. Your doctor may also recommend a nocturnal penile tumescence (NPT) test to measure erections during sleep.
Understand treatment options. These can range from lifestyle changes (diet, exercise, stress management) and medication (phosphodiesterase-5 inhibitors, hormone therapy) to surgical interventions, such as penile implants or vascular surgery. Your doctor will help you choose the best approach for your specific situation.
Follow your doctor’s recommendations carefully. This includes taking prescribed medications as directed and attending follow-up appointments. Regular checkups are important to monitor your progress and adjust treatment as needed.
Possible Causes | Tests/Assessments |
---|---|
Hormonal imbalances | Blood tests (testosterone, prolactin) |
Vascular disease | Doppler ultrasound |
Neurological problems | Nerve conduction studies |
Psychological factors | Psychological evaluation |

Finding Safe and Effective Treatment Options
Consult a healthcare professional. They can accurately diagnose the underlying cause of erectile dysfunction and recommend the best treatment plan for your individual needs. This includes discussing your medical history and lifestyle factors.
Consider lifestyle changes. Regular exercise, a balanced diet, and stress management techniques can significantly improve erectile function. Quitting smoking and limiting alcohol consumption are also crucial steps.
Explore prescription medications. Your doctor might prescribe medications like phosphodiesterase-5 (PDE5) inhibitors, such as sildenafil (Viagra), tadalafil (Cialis), or vardenafil (Levitra). They’ll help determine the appropriate dosage and monitor for any side effects.
Discuss alternative therapies. In some cases, your doctor may suggest other options, such as hormone therapy or penile implants. These are usually considered when medication isn’t effective or suitable.
Seek mental health support. Underlying anxiety or depression can contribute to erectile dysfunction. Therapy and counseling can address these issues, improving both mental and physical well-being.
Prioritize open communication. Honest conversations with your partner can alleviate stress and improve intimacy, leading to better sexual function.
